A fresh salad made with romaine lettuce and antibiotic-free chicken breast. It is topped with toasted almonds, sesame seeds, and crispy wonton strips, then finished with Asian Sesame Vinaigrette for a sweet and slightly salty taste.

Ingredients

  • Romaine lettuce
  • Seared chicken breast
  • Toasted almonds
  • Crispy wonton strips
  • Sesame seeds
  • Asian Sesame Vinaigrette (soy, sesame oil, ginger, sugar)

Allergens

  • Contains: Tree Nuts (almonds), Wheat, Soy, Sesame
  • May have cross-contact with milk, eggs, peanuts, and fish.

FAQs

1. Is the Asian Sesame Chicken Salad gluten-free?

No. The wonton strips contain wheat. You can remove them, but cross-contact may still happen in the kitchen.

2. Can I order it in a “You Pick Two”?

Yes. You can choose a half salad and pair it with a half sandwich, soup, or small mac and cheese.

3. Is the chicken warm or cold?

The chicken is usually served chilled or at room temperature on top of the fresh greens.

4. Why is the dressing called “Asian-style”?

It is made with soy sauce and sesame oil, mixed with ginger, onion, and garlic for a sweet and savory taste.
